Dave we put H&R springs in my dads E46 m3 when a rear coil broke and it lowered it nicely. There is a issue with the E46 when lowered where there is notably more understeer - turner motorsport makes an adjustable rear control arm to correct the camber issues that wear these tires - the tire wear is just the cost you pay to have a car that drives like these do but you know that.
